What problem this template solves
Fleet safety software often fails to convert because the landing page buries the value. Visitors see a generic headline, a stock photo, and a wall of features. They leave before they trust the product. This template solves that by front-loading quantified outcomes and making the data impossible to ignore.
- Safety managers and fleet managers need to see real numbers before they hand over a work email. This template opens with animated metrics: incident reduction at 73%, fleet compliance score at 98.4%, and response time dropping from hours to minutes.
- Logistics and transportation buyers are skeptical of vendor claims. The alternating spec-sheet layout pairs every technical detail with a human outcome, so the visitor benchmarks their own fleet against the evidence as they scroll.

Feature list
This section describes the built-in capabilities included in the Dispatch template as defined in the source brief.
Animated Stats Hero Panel
The left hero panel renders live-style counter animations: an incident reduction percentage counting from 0 to 73%, a fleet compliance score ticking to 98.4%, and a response-time counter dropping from hours to minutes. All numerals display in electric teal against the deep operational black background. This gives fleet managers an immediate, visceral sense of what the software delivers before they read a single word of copy.
Alternating Spec-Sheet Scroll
Three scroll sections split the screen between a hard technical specification on the left and a human outcome on the right. The first tier covers individual driver performance data. The second covers fleet-wide analytics. The third covers enterprise compliance reporting. Each tier reveals deeper capability as the visitor scrolls, mimicking the experience of peeling layers off an engineering whitepaper. Numbers are typeset large in teal, with metric formats referencing CSA BASIC percentile, Total Recordable Incident Rate reduction, and preventable-crash ratio.
Fixed Lead Capture Form
After the second scroll section, a lead capture form locks to the right panel and stays visible as the visitor continues reading. The form includes three fields only: fleet size as a dropdown with four ranges, primary operation type with options for over-the-road, regional, last-mile, and warehousing, and work email. No phone number is required. A secondary call-to-action below the form offers the ROI Calculator download gated behind email only, giving hesitant visitors a lower-commitment path.
Results Bento Grid
A dedicated results section uses a bento grid layout to display quantified social proof. Cells highlight CSA BASIC percentile improvements, Total Recordable Incident Rate reductions, insurance premium drops, and audit pass rates. Each cell is a self-contained data statement designed to resonate with the specific pain points of fleet safety buyers.
Integration and Device Wall
A full-width integration section displays compatibility with Electronic Logging Device hardware, Department of Transportation and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ration standards, and API connections. This section helps fleet managers and logistics teams quickly confirm that the software fits their existing stack without reading a support page.

Design & branding system
The Dispatch template uses an AI Iridescent color system on a Startup Velocity theme. The palette feels futuristic but operationally grounded, built for the workstation screens that fleet safety managers actually use every morning.
- Colors: deep operational black (#0B0E14) for all backgrounds, electric teal (#00E5CC) for safe-state data and positive metrics, holographic violet (#7B5EA7) for alerts and interactive elements, and signal white (#F0F0F5) for all body text and data labels. Hover states and scroll transitions shift colors subtly, creating the impression of an interface that is actively thinking.
- Typography: JetBrains Mono for all data labels, counters, and spec-sheet figures. Manrope for headlines and body copy. The combination of a monospace data font with a clean humanist headline font reinforces the command-center aesthetic while keeping text clinical and scannable.
Mobile & speed optimization
The Dispatch template is built desktop-first, reflecting the reality that fleet safety managers primarily work from workstations. The layout is also fully responsive for mobile access in the field.
- The split-screen panels stack vertically on smaller screens so all content remains accessible and readable without horizontal scrolling or element overlap
- Counter animations and scroll-reveal transitions use client-side rendering only for interactive sections, while static content uses server components to keep the initial load light and the experience smooth on mobile devices
